Mock leading: Sport Climbing for beginners

Take your indoor climbing to a new level with lead climbing. Learn how to climb from the ground up, trailing a rope and clipping pre-placed bolts as you go. Practice techniques for tying in, clipping quickdraws, falling safely and belaying a leader. All equipment provided. Prerequisite: Checked off to belay at UMD's climbing walls.

Mock leading: Trad Climbing for beginners

Traditional lead climbers use nuts, tri- cams, spring-loaded camming devices and other gear to place temporary anchors in cracks as they climb up a route. Learn techniques for getting started, placing anchors, route strategies and belaying a leader. All equipment provided. Prerequisite: Checked off to belay at UMD's climbing walls.

The Summit Challenge

At 5,112ft above sea level, Devil's Tower requires over 1280ft of climbing. The challenge: climb the equivalent height of Devil's Tower on the North Shore Wall. Succeed and you'll win a t-shirt! Ask a climbing staff for more info.
